Understanding Project-Based Learning
PBL involves students working on a project over an extended period, culminating in a tangible product or presentation. Key characteristics include:
- Real-World Relevance: Projects address authentic, complex questions or problems.
- Student-Centered Approach: Students have a voice in project design and execution.
- Interdisciplinary Learning: Projects often integrate multiple subject areas.
- Collaboration: Emphasis on teamwork and communication skills.

Conclusion
Project-Based Learning offers a dynamic and inclusive approach to education, particularly in diverse K-12 classrooms. By thoughtfully designing projects, differentiating instruction, fostering collaboration, integrating technology, and maintaining continuous assessment, educators can create enriching learning experiences that cater to the varied needs of their students.
